Skenes Creek vs Tanybryn
Suburb / Locality comparison ≈ 6.7 km apart · Skenes Creek profile · Tanybryn profile
Skenes Creek Tanybryn
Skenes Creek and Tanybryn are neighbouring rural areas with very different financial and physical profiles. Tanybryn is sparsely populated and much wealthier, with a typical weekly household income of $2,250 compared to $1,260 in Skenes Creek. This wealth is also seen in home loans, where the typical monthly payment in Tanybryn is $2,884, far higher than the $1,450 typical payment in Skenes Creek. Skenes Creek has a more connected layout, with 95.4% of homes within a 15-minute walk of a park, while only 2.6% of homes in Tanybryn have that access.
Both areas are similarly isolated, with neither having any homes within a 15-minute walk of a school, grocery store, or health service. They also share a car-dependent lifestyle, though the typical resident in Tanybryn is noticeably older at 62 compared to 55 in Skenes Creek. While both are far older than the national figure, Tanybryn's residents are slightly older and earn a typical weekly personal income that is well higher than in Skenes Creek.
